Vue和jQuery绑方法详解_jQuery_没问题下面我会用通俗易懂的方式一步步带你完成这个过程

Vue和jQuery绑定的方法详解

想要在Vue项目中使用jQuery的强大DOM操作功能?没问题,下面我会用通俗易懂的方式,一步步带你完成这个过程。

一、在Vue中引入jQuery

我们需要把jQuery带到我们的Vue项目中来。

二、在Vue组件中使用jQuery操作DOM

接下来,我们可以开始在Vue组件中使用jQuery来操作DOM了。

三、确保Vue生命周期和jQuery操作之间的正确调用顺序

为了确保jQuery操作正常工作,我们需要注意Vue的生命周期和jQuery操作的顺序。

通过以上三个步骤,你就可以在Vue项目中成功绑定和使用jQuery了。记得,虽然jQuery可以提供强大的DOM操作,但在Vue项目中,建议尽可能减少直接操作DOM,充分利用Vue的数据绑定和组件化优势。

相关问答FAQs

1. 如何在Vue中与jQuery绑定元素?

在Vue中与jQuery绑定元素可以通过使用属性和对象来实现。在Vue模板中给要绑定的元素添加一个属性,然后在Vue实例中使用来访问该元素。接下来,可以使用jQuery的选择器来选择和操作该元素。

Vue模板 Vue实例
<div id="myElement"></div> methods: { el: document.getElementById('myElement') }
<div v-ref:myElement></div> mounted() { this.$refs.myElement.style.color = 'red'; }

2. 如何在Vue中使用jQuery插件?

在Vue中使用jQuery插件可以通过在Vue组件的生命周期钩子函数中引入和初始化插件来实现。在项目中引入jQuery和所需的插件文件。然后,在Vue组件的钩子函数中初始化插件。

jQuery插件 Vue组件
$(document).ready(function() { $('#myElement').hover(function() { // 插件操作 }); }); mounted() { $('#myElement').hover(function() { // 插件操作 }); }

3. Vue和jQuery如何进行数据交互?

Vue和jQuery可以通过Ajax方法进行数据交互。Vue提供了axios等库来进行网络请求,而jQuery则提供了$.ajax等方法。

Vue jQuery
methods: { fetchData() { axios.get('/api/data').then(response => { this.data = response.data; }); } } $.ajax({ url: '/api/data', method: 'GET', success: function(data) { // 处理数据 } });